Soundwave's precious Felis catus gets a shiny upgrade. As we revealed earlier, the exclusive mail-order figure from the Battlefield Bumblebee vs. Infiltration Soundwave two-pack is a repaint of Deluxe Ravage. In what could be only described as a megacycle, Yizhi of TF08.net has posted an image of the figure for us to see.

Another look at Mail-In Exclusive Ravage

The picture reveals yellow translucent plastic, and a big surprise, some shiny chrome work! For details on how to obtain Ravage, check out this previous news post.
